Your Itinerary

The Bank of America Stadium

(Pass by)

See the home of the Carolina Panthers, and Charlotte FC Major League Soccer

The Duke Mansion

(Pass by)

Drive by the lovely, historic Duke Mansion once home to James B Duke. Lean the history of this beautiful home that is now a B&B

Truist Field

(Pass by)

Truist Field home to the Charlotte Knights a Triple A Minor League Baseball team.

Fourth Ward Park

(Pass by)

Fourth Ward Historic District featuring a mix of architectural styles, homes dating back to the 1800's which were saved from demolition and restored. A truly hidden historic area right uptown.

Spectrum Center

(Pass by)

Home of the NBA's Charlotte Hornets

Queen Charlotte Statue

(Pass by)

A life size statue of Queen Charlotte, wife of King George lll of Great Britian. She is the namesake of our city, Charlotte and our county of Mecklenburg.

Queens University of Charlotte

(Pass by)

A private university with approximately 2,300 undergraduate and graduate students. It was founded in 1857 as a women's institute.

NASCAR Hall of Fame

(Pass by)

We pass by and point out the NASCAR Hall of Fame an interactive entertainment attraction honoring the history and heritage of NASCAR.
